PORK STIR FRY WITH BLACK BEAN SAUCE
Quick and easy pork slice stir-fried with black bean sauce
Provided by Elaine
Categories Main Course
Time 20m
Number Of Ingredients 17
Steps:
- Thinly slice the pork. Add salt, cooking wine, light soy sauce, water (or chicken stock) and white pepper. Message the pork slice for 2-3 minutes until all the juice is well absorbed. Set aside for 10 minutes.
- Add cornstarch and message again. Make sure all the slices are well coated with starch. At last, add 1 teaspoon of sesame oil, mix well too.
- Heat your wok or pan firstly. Add cooking oil to form a 2-3 cm high layer (do not be scared by the oil amount, we do not eat them all). Spread the pork sliced in. Let them stay for 5 to 10 seconds and then quickly fry them until turns pale. Transfer out immediately.
- Remove the extra oil and save them for vegetable stir fries. Keep around 1 tablespoon of oil and fry garlic, ginger and scallion until aromatic. Place fresh pepper sections in to fry for 1 minute or until slightly softened. Return pork sliced in, add dark soy sauce and black beans sauce. Mix well and see if any extra salt is needed. Move out immediately after mixed. Be quick in this process and it is better to finish this within 30 seconds.

PORK AND BLACK BEAN SAUCE
Purchased stir-fry sauce gives this Asian recipe a quick zip of flavor.
Provided by Betty Crocker Kitchens
Categories Entree
Time 21m
Yield 4
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- Remove fat from pork. Cut pork into 2x1x1/8-inch strips. Mix stir-fry sauce and bean sauce.
- Spray wok or 12-inch skillet with cooking spray; heat over high heat. Add pork; stir-fry about 3 minutes or until no longer pink in center. Add peas, zucchini and bell pepper; stir-fry 2 minutes.
- Stir in sauce mixture; cook and stir 1 minute.

PORK AND BLACK BEAN STEW
My Brazilian friend makes this for me occasionally and it is fabulous!
Provided by MICHELLE0011
Categories Soups, Stews and Chili Recipes Stews Pork
Time 1h
Yield 4
Number Of Ingredients 10
Steps:
- Heat 1 tablespoon vegetable oil in a skillet over medium heat, stir in garlic and onion, and cook a few minutes until the onion softens and turns translucent. Remove the onion, and place into a saucepan. Pour the remaining 1 tablespoon vegetable oil into the skillet, and place over medium-high heat. Add cubed pork, and cook until well browned.
- Meanwhile, pour 3/4 of the black beans along with 1/4 cup water into the bowl of a blender, and pulse until finely chopped, but not quite smooth. Pour whole beans and bean puree into saucepan along with pork cubes, chicken stock, chorizo, and bay leaves. Bring to a boil over medium-high heat, then reduce heat to medium-low, cover, and simmer 30 minutes. Season to taste with salt and pepper before serving.

PORK ROAST WITH BLACK BEAN SAUCE
Categories Bean Citrus Marinate Roast Sauté Pork Tenderloin Plantain Bon Appétit
Yield Serves 8
Number Of Ingredients 21
Steps:
- For pork:
- Combine first 8 ingredients in 13x9x2-inch baking dish. Add pork loins, turning to coat. Cover and refrigerate overnight, turning occasionally.
- For bean sauce:
- Heat 1 tablespoon olive oil in heavy large saucepan over medium-high heat. Add pepper, onion and garlic; sauté until onion is tender and golden, about 7 minutes. Add beans and broth. Simmer until slightly thickened, stirring often, about 8 minutes. Stir in Worcestershire sauce and hot pepper sauce. Season with salt and pepper. (Can be made 2 hours ahead. Cover and let stand at room temperature.)
- Preheat oven to 400°F. Remove pork from marinade; discard marinade. Season pork with salt and pepper. Heat remaining 1 tablespoon oil in heavy large skillet over medium-high heat. Working in batches, add pork and sauté until brown on all sides, about 10 minutes per batch. Transfer to heavy large baking sheet with rim.
- Roast pork 10 minutes. Arrange plantain slices around pork on baking sheet. Bake until thermometer inserted into thickest part of pork registers 160°F and plantains are tender, brushing plantains occasionally with pan juices, about 20 minutes.
- Arrange plantains in center of platter. Cut pork into 1-inch-thick slices. Arrange pork around plantains. Rewarm sauce. Stir in cilantro. Spoon sauce around edge of platter and serve.
